Overview
Wekiva River, the same river Temucuan Indians used to fish on, is located at a park that offers a respectful way of interacting with nature and the land’s history. Relax in grass settings and bathe in tranquil waters. Wheelchair-friendly restrooms are available and there is an accessible entrance to the water, through a ramp as well as a stair-lift
.Taking a hike, riding a bicycle or just chilling in the park are only some of the few possibilities, and service animals are more than welcome. Strolling around the boardwalk that surrounds the lake will give you amazing views and memories.
